Samuel Hazo is the author of poetry, fiction, essays, various works of translation and four plays.
He is the founder and director of the International Poetry Forum in Pittsburgh, PA. Hazo has received numerous awards during his writing career including the Maurice English Poetry Award and the Griffin Award for Creative Writing from the University of Notre Dame, his alma mater. He was also the first State Poet of the Commonwealth of Pennsylvania.
